2013-03-29 86 views
0

我們最近從Jackrabbit 2.4.0升級到Jackrabbit 2.6.0。 Jackrabbit被部署到JBoss AS 7.1.0中。我們仍然使用Java 6. 從Jackrabbit 2.6.0清單文件我們可以看到,它是使用Java 7構建的。 有沒有什麼可以擔心在Java 6中使用Jackrabbit 2.6.0(實際上是否有任何Java 7中使用的特定功能? Jackrabbit 2.6.0 codebase)?Jackrabbit 2.6.0與Java的兼容性6

回答

2

2.6版本的Jackrabbit parent POM清楚地表明使用Java 6編譯。

相關章節粘貼下面

<plugin> 
    <artifactId>maven-compiler-plugin</artifactId> 
    <configuration> 
     <target>1.6</target> 
     <source>1.6</source> 
    </configuration> 
    </plugin> 
    <!-- Generate aggregate Javadocs --> 
    <plugin> 
    <artifactId>maven-javadoc-plugin</artifactId> 
    <configuration> 
     <source>1.6</source> 
     <aggregate>true</aggregate> 
     <links> 
     <link>http://docs.oracle.com/javase/6/docs/api/</link> 
     <link>http://www.day.com/maven/javax.jcr/javadocs/jcr-2.0/</link> 
     </links> 
    </configuration> 
    </plugin> 
    <!-- JCR-988: IDE plugins --> 
    <plugin> 
    <!-- http://maven.apache.org/plugins/maven-idea-plugin/ --> 
    <artifactId>maven-idea-plugin</artifactId> 
    <configuration> 
     <downloadSources>true</downloadSources> 
     <jdkLevel>1.6</jdkLevel> 
    </configuration> 
    </plugin> 
+0

感謝。這就是我需要知道的。 –